The record of primordial noble gases in ureilites imposes serious
constraints on models of ureilite petrogenesis. It is argued that the
inhomogeneous distribution between different mineral phases and the low
40 Ar / 36 Ar ratio in particular can only be satisfied with
difficulties in the model proposed by Berkley et al.
